TEMPO.CO, Jakarta - More than 100 companies, including AI giants OpenAI, Anthropic, Google and Perplexity, have signed an open letter calling for a global effort to strengthen AI-powered cybersecurity threats, DW reported.
"We have a limited window to strengthen cyber defenses," the letter read. "In the coming months, AI-enabled cyber attacks will become far more widespread and sophisticated as models around the world become increasingly capable."
Other signatories to the open letter include Adobe, AMD, Cisco, Dell, Oracle, IBM and German tech giant SAP as well as Deutsche Telekom.
Letter urges more funding, resources for cybersecurity
The companies called for a broad response, ranging from end-user companies strengthening their own security protocols to "frontier AI companies" building new observability and security tools to cope with AI-powered threats.
In particular, they also called on governments to pay for local and international responses to new threats to cybersecurity.
"Fund cyber defense, starting with essential services that lack the staff or budget to act," the letter read.
In the United States, the Trump administration imposed deep cuts to the U.S. Cybersecurity and Infrastructure Security Agency (CISA) last year, cutting staff by around a third.
The letter also urged governments to "expedite the expansion of trusted access programs, especially for critical infrastructure supply chains, and broaden access to defensive capabilities for other defenders."
AI agents reportedly go rogue
Last month, OpenAI said two of its models escaped their test environment, gained access to the internet and attacked Hugging Face, a site that AI developers use to store and share code.
The incident prompted Anthropic to check if its own models had also carried out similar attacks. It found three incidents in which a Claude model broke out of its testing environment and breached the systems of three organizations.
In June, the "Five Eyes" intelligence community — consisting of the U.S., the UK, Canada, Australia and New Zealand — issued a rare joint statement warning that new AI models were "fundamentally transforming both offensive and defensive cyber capabilities."
"The timeline is not years, it is months," the statement said.
